Output 09e103229572512ddfcc6b6d219a2db6590a2e97b0a64c7e63b2280b3a668bb5:1

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 8fe8a8607710ce841546067052a789c3f99f1672
address
bc1q3l52scrhzr8gg92xqec99fufc0ue79njy65j60
transaction
09e103229572512ddfcc6b6d219a2db6590a2e97b0a64c7e63b2280b3a668bb5
confirmations
99253
spent
true